Use of Recycled Materials

One of the standout features of WPC decking tiles is their reliance on recycled materials. These tiles are crafted by combining wood fibers, often from reclaimed sawdust or wood waste, with thermoplastics derived from recycled plastic products like bottles and bags. This innovative blend reduces the demand for virgin raw materials, helping conserve natural resources.
Environmental Impact: By repurposing waste materials, WPC decking tiles contribute to waste reduction and prevent landfill overflow.
Conservation of Trees: Using wood fibers from recycled or scrap wood minimizes the need for cutting down trees, preserving forests and biodiversity.
Support for Recycling Initiatives: WPC manufacturing encourages recycling, creating a demand for recyclable plastics and wood waste.

Reduced Environmental Footprint

WPC decking tiles are designed to have a smaller environmental footprint compared to traditional wood and synthetic decking materials. Several factors contribute to this reduced impact:
Lower Energy Consumption: The production process for WPC materials typically requires less energy than the manufacturing of pure plastic or aluminum decking.
Longevity and Durability: WPC decking tiles have a longer lifespan than natural wood, reducing the frequency of replacement and the associated resource consumption.
Eco-Friendly Maintenance: Unlike traditional wooden decks, WPC tiles do not require chemical treatments, stains, or sealants, minimizing the release of volatile organic compounds (VOCs) into the environment.

Lifecycle Analysis

A lifecycle analysis (LCA) of WPC decking tiles reveals their environmental advantages across various stages of their life:
Raw Material Sourcing: WPC tiles make efficient use of recycled materials, reducing dependence on non-renewable resources.
Production Phase: Manufacturing processes for WPC products produce fewer emissions and waste than many alternatives, making them more sustainable.
Usage Phase: The durability of WPC decking tiles ensures a long functional life with minimal maintenance, lowering the overall environmental impact.
End-of-Life Recycling: At the end of their lifecycle, WPC tiles can be recycled again, closing the loop in a circular economy model.
